What kind of oil does a 2007 Honda Shadow Spirit 1100 take?

The engine uses 10W-40 motorcycle oil; the primary/transmission typically uses the same oil; engine oil capacity is about 3.4 quarts (with filter). Check the owner's manual for exact quantities and climate-specific guidance.


For riders and owners, understanding the oil requirements for the VT1100 Shadow Spirit 1100 involves both the engine oil and the lubrication of the primary/transmission. This article explains the recommended oil types, viscosities, and how climate and riding conditions can influence your choice, along with practical notes on primary lubrication and maintenance intervals.


Engine oil specifications


Engine oil options, including viscosity and certification standards, are summarized below.


Viscosity and oil grade guidance



  • Viscosity: 10W-40 is the standard recommendation for most riding conditions. In very hot climates or heavy-use riding, some riders opt for a thicker grade such as 20W-50; in very cold climates, a lighter grade like 5W-40 can be used, but always confirm with the owner's manual.

  • Oil type/standards: Use motorcycle-grade oil that meets API SN/SM or newer and JASO MA or MA2 rating. You can choose conventional mineral oil, synthetic, or synthetic-blend, as long as it meets these specs.

  • Capacity: Engine oil capacity (with filter change) is about 3.4 quarts (approximately 3.2–3.5 L). The primary/transmission uses a smaller amount of oil; refer to the manual for the exact primary oil capacity (roughly around 0.8–0.9 quarts) and fill procedure.


When selecting oil, prioritize motorcycle-specific formulations and correct API/JASO ratings over automotive oils.


Primary and transmission oil considerations


The VT1100 Shadow Spirit generally uses motorcycle oil for the engine and the primary drive; there is typically no separate automotive transmission oil required. However, some markets or model variations may specify a dedicated primary lubricant, so always verify with your local manual or dealer.


Oil for primary and transmission



  • Primary/Transmission oil: In most Shadow VT1100s, the primary chamber is lubricated by the same grade as the engine oil (commonly 10W-40). If your manual indicates a dedicated primary oil, follow that specification exactly.

  • Change intervals: Change engine oil according to the schedule in your owner’s manual, typically every 3,000–5,000 miles for mineral oil; synthetic oils can extend intervals depending on riding conditions and manufacturer guidance.

  • Quality notes: Use motorcycle-grade oil that is suitable for wet-clutch operation, and avoid oils with additives that could harm the clutch or seals. Do not mix oils of incompatible types or brands without consulting the manual.


In practice, most owners use 10W-40 motorcycle oil for both engine and primary, changing per the manual’s recommended interval and capacity.


Summary


The 2007 Honda Shadow Spirit 1100 typically requires a 10W-40 motorcycle oil that meets API SN/SM or newer standards and JASO MA/MA2. Engine and primary lubrication generally use the same oil, with an engine capacity around 3.4 quarts and a smaller primary capacity. Climate and riding style can influence viscosity choice (e.g., 20W-50 in heat; 5W-40 in cold conditions). Always verify exact specs in the owner's manual or with a Honda dealer, and use motorcycle-grade oil appropriate for wet clutches.
